Atlanta Botanical Garden
1345 Piedmont Avenue NE, Atlanta, GA 30309
The Atlanta Botanical Garden is situated on 30 sprawling acres in Midtown Atlanta. Created in the 1970s with a mission of developing and maintaining plant collections for “display, education, research, conservation and enjoyment”, the Botanical Garden remains a point of interest for visitors and residents of Atlanta alike. The Garden includes an enviable orchid collection, a tropical conservatory full of animals, a rose garden, and an edible outdoor garden, just to name a few of its many attractions.

Walk the BeltLine Trail to Ponce City Market
Suggested route: Enter the Trail at the SE corner of the Atlanta Botanical Garden and walk to Ponce City Market.
The Atlanta BeltLine is nothing short of a community feat, demonstrating Atlanta’s ingenuity and creativity. As a sustainable redevelopment project, the BeltLine, when comple, will connect 45 neighborhoods through a 33-mile loop of multi-use trail. The hope is that the BeltLine will offer Atlanta the opportunity to redefine and connect its diverse neighborhoods. You can hop on and off the BeltLine throughout the city, allowing for easy access between neighborhoods and cultural attractions.

Explore Ponce City Market
675 Ponce De Leon Avenue NE, Atlanta, GA 30308
Located just off the BeltLine in the old Sears, Roebuck & Company building you will find Ponce City Market, a mixed-use space full of restaurants, boutiques, and bars. The unique urban marketplace has a community-oriented feel, featuring tables interspersed throughout, making it the perfect place to gather, work, or play.

The Center for Civil and Human Rights
100 Ivan Allen Jr. Boulevard NW, Atlanta, GA 30313
In addition to being full of fun attractions, Atlanta also offers educational opportunities abound, including the Center for Civil and Human Rights. The Center, established in 2007, was founded to inspire visitors to take the fundamental rights of every human being personally.

SkyView Atlanta Ferris Wheel
168 Luckie Street NW, Atlanta, GA 30303
If you are looking for a unique, sprawling view of the city, look no further than SkyView Atlanta. Located next to Centennial Olympic Park, SkyView Atlanta offers unrestricted views from 20-stories high. The climate controlled gondolas are the perfect place to take in the city from above.
